34 COSSMA 5I2014 PRODUCTION PACKAGING NEWS NEWS Events Interpack 2014 also has something up its sleeve for the cosmetics industry Interpack I From May the 8th to the 14th some 2,700 exhibitors from about 60 countries will be occupying 19 halls (or around some 174,000 square metres) at the Interpack in Düsseldorf where they will be present- ing their wares to all sectors of industry. Of the above exhibitors there will be more than 1,160 companies with something in their portfolios for the cosmetics industry. The new event being run in parallel with the exhibition, with a daily pro- gramme of talks and discussions, will be taking place in the Congress Center South (CCD Süd) from May the 8th to the 10th , and is entitled Components for processing and packaging. Here there will be 75 ex- hibitors presenting their services as suppliers to the packaging sector. In addition the exhibition will include companies that offer drive and control systems, sensors of various types, products for industrial image process- ing, handling technology, industrial software and communications equip- ment, as well as complete automation systems for packaging machinery. As early as 1995 a number of packag- ing companies clubbed together to tackle this trend and estab- lish the Service Pack Forum, holding smaller exhibitions, per- haps in a hotel, several times a year, where they could use these regional events to attract their specific clients. The P360˚ event, also known as “Packaging Ideas”, is in effect a relaunch of this initiative which involves an overall concept, with a small exhibition, an inclusive evening dinner or show in a spe- cial location and so creating an attractive event. This idea was premiered on April 10th 2014 in the Schwetzinger Schloss near Heidelberg, Germany. The event, supported by 12 companies, attracted more than 60 customers. As its filling circuit is ded- icated to nail varnish, it optimizes the circuit recharging in order to counter the effects of elasticity and deformation of the product (thick fluid and small dose). It allows filling without damaging glitter particles as well as a good dose distribution in all bottles. For man- ufacturers dealing with short runs it offers the advantage of tool- free changeovers taking less than 40 seconds, and a quick clean- ing time.
